Sean McDermott rules out Bills DT DaQuan Jones, WR Joshua Palmer and S Taylor Rapp for Week 8 game at Panthers

Bills head coach Sean McDermott appeared on WGR550 this morning and has ruled out defensive tackle DaQuan Jones (calf), wide receiver Joshua Palmer (knee/ankle) and safety Taylor Rapp (knee) for Sunday's game against Carolina.

Jones, Palmer and Rapp did not participate in practices this week. McDermott also said that Rapp will be placed on Injured Reserve, sidelining him for a minimum of four games.

"It came up in training camp unfortunately and he was dealing with it since then," McDermott told WGR550. "It just got to the point where he's just not able to really be himself. And so, we're making the decision right now through the medical people's opinion that we'll put him on IR and we'll take it one week at a time right now."

McDermott added that at this point it doesn't seem like Jones or Palmer will need to be placed on IR.

"Feeling more comfortable that it's not going to lead to IR," he said. "Can't say we're out of the woods yet on either of those two at this point, but feel like we're heading in the right direction."

Linebacker Terrel Bernard (ankle), linebacker Matt Milano (pectoral), tight end Dalton Kincaid (oblique) and wide receiver Curtis Samuel (ribs) were all limited for Wednesday and Thursday's practice.

According to McDermott, Samuel will be a full participant for Friday's practice and will be good for Sunday's game. McDermott said Bernard, Milano and Kincaid will be limited for Friday's practice and questionable for Sunday.

Rookie cornerback Maxwell Hairston's 21-day practice window was opened this week. The rookie was limited in practice on Wednesday and Thursday.

McDermott has liked what he's seen out of Hairston this week.

"He's done some good things," McDermott said. "He really has. Again, just managing the expectations. And you want to take it one day at a time. There is a lot that's new for him because of the amount of time that he's missed due to the injury."

McDermott said "we'll see" when asked if Hairston will be activated for Sunday's game.

Defensive tackle Larry Ogunjobi and defensive end Michael Hoecht returned from suspension this week. McDermott said the two will appear in Sunday's game against Carolina.
